The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Dec. 03, 2019

Filed:

Dec. 28, 2015
Applicant:

Amazon Technologies, Inc., Seattle, WA (US);

Inventors:

Leah Shalev, Zichron Yaakov, IL;

Nafea Bshara, San Jose, CA (US);

Georgy Machulsky, San Jose, CA (US);

Brian William Barrett, Seattle, WA (US);

Assignee:

Amazon Technologies, Inc., Seattle, WA (US);

Attorney:
Primary Examiner:
Assistant Examiner:
Int. Cl.
CPC ...
H04L 12/803 (2013.01); G06F 9/448 (2018.01); H04L 12/26 (2006.01); H04L 12/707 (2013.01); H04L 12/721 (2013.01); H04L 12/741 (2013.01); H04L 12/947 (2013.01); H04L 29/12 (2006.01); H04L 29/06 (2006.01); H04L 29/08 (2006.01); G06F 9/50 (2006.01); G06F 8/36 (2018.01); G06F 9/4401 (2018.01);
U.S. Cl.
CPC ...
H04L 47/125 (2013.01); G06F 9/4494 (2018.02); G06F 9/5005 (2013.01); H04L 29/08 (2013.01); H04L 43/0823 (2013.01); H04L 43/0852 (2013.01); H04L 45/24 (2013.01); H04L 45/72 (2013.01); H04L 45/74 (2013.01); H04L 49/25 (2013.01); H04L 61/2007 (2013.01); H04L 69/10 (2013.01); H04L 69/16 (2013.01); H04L 69/22 (2013.01); G06F 8/36 (2013.01); G06F 9/4411 (2013.01);
Abstract

Disclosed herein is a method including receiving, from a user application, data to be transmitted from a source address to a destination address using a single connection through a network; and splitting the data into a plurality of packets according to a communication protocol. For each packet of the plurality of packets, a respective flowlet for the packet to be transmitted in is determined from a plurality of flowlets; a field in the packet used by a network switch of the network to route the packet is set based on the determined flowlet for the packet; and the packet is sent via the determined flowlet for transmitting through the network.


Find Patent Forward Citations

Loading…